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95510978529 5518509 3905411226
75 90795 8682
75 90795 8682
409608 30918328 72147 389 18
All about undefined
Interested in learning more?
75 90795 8682
409608 30918328 72147 389 18
See more
51036012992 3535874 802737593
02 410 254
See more
6516220 9223812665 911862241
1254560141 944 052 630252804 12790337850
See more